The Big Beautiful Bill – What’s Inside?

At its core, the bill seeks to reshape how America approaches taxation, healthcare, defense, and immigration. But don’t let the dramatic title fool you—it’s a blend of bold promises and controversial measures that have sparked heated debates on both sides of the political spectrum.

Tax Cuts: A Double-Edged Sword?

The bill includes several tax cuts, which, at first glance, seem like a win for everyday Americans. Notably, the extension of individual tax rates from Trump’s 2017 Tax Cuts and Jobs Act is a victory for many. For the average taxpayer, the cuts mean more disposable income. But the real kicker? The cap on the state and local tax (SALT) deduction is raised to $40,000—benefiting high-income earners disproportionately.

The truth? While it might feel like a boost for the working class, much of the benefit is tilted towards the wealthy. The question arises: is this bill really for the people, or just for those with deeper pockets?

Spending Cuts and Defense

When Trump talks about cutting government spending, it’s never without controversy. This bill is no exception. Massive cuts to Medicaid and Medicare, as well as public health programs, are set to take place. With nearly 11 million Americans expected to lose their healthcare coverage, this provision has sparked protests and public outcry.

Yet, the bill also includes a jaw-dropping increase in defense spending, including a $25 billion allocation for Trump’s much-touted “Golden Dome” missile defense system. For Trump, national security is always a top priority, but at what cost to social programs that millions depend on?

The Immigration Issue – Hardline Enforcement

Immigration enforcement gets a major boost with this bill, allocating $150 billion for border control and deportations. It’s a blow to the hopes of those advocating for a more compassionate approach to immigration. In a country built on diversity, this measure could be seen as a step backward.

Trump’s push for strict immigration policies, such as expanding ICE’s funding, may satisfy his base, but it leaves many questioning the future of undocumented immigrants in the U.S. Will this drive further polarization, or will it lead to the “strong borders” that Trump has long championed?

Democratic Reactions: A Bitter Pill to Swallow

Democrats have been quick to criticize the bill, arguing that it prioritizes tax cuts for the rich and penalizes low-income Americans. The proposal to cut Medicaid and Medicare funding could leave millions without essential healthcare, a point that has caused widespread concern among liberal circles.

Ken Martin, Chair of the Democratic National Committee, called the bill a “betrayal of the American people,” emphasizing that its passage could spell disaster for Democrats in the 2026 elections. In fact, protests have erupted across the country, with thousands taking to the streets to voice their opposition to the bill’s provisions.
